Britney slapped with restraining order:
It emerged yesterday that Britney Spears was issued with a restraining order to keep her away from K-Fed, on the same day as the bizarre three-hour siege. The erratic starlet was ordered to stay 30m away from her “victim”, but K-Fed himself denies he had anything to do with it. We’re glad he said that, as we were really struggling with the image of the wannabe rapper as a cowering victim. Since the stand-off at her home, when Brit refused to hand over her kids to her ex, she has lost all her visitation rights and the police have issued a temporary order called an "emergency protective order”, which will last for five days. If Brit comes within 100 feet of Kevin she faces arrest. He needn’t worry, though, because Brit has clearly decided to go a lot further than 100 feet – the star and her “only friend”, paparazzi photographer Adnan Ghalib, were spotted arriving in New York today.
